    Option 1

    def first_last(df):
        return df.ix[[0, -1]]
    
    df.groupby(level=0, group_keys=False).apply(first_last)
    


    Option 2 - only works if index is unique

    idx = df.index.to_series().groupby(level=0).agg(['first', 'last']).stack()
    df.loc[idx]
    

    Option 3 - per notes below, this only makes sense when there are no NAs

    I also abused the agg function. The code below works, but is far uglier.

    df.reset_index(1).groupby(level=0).agg(['first', 'last']).stack() \
        .set_index('level_1', append=True).reset_index(1, drop=True) \
        .rename_axis([None, None])
    

    Note

    per @unutbu: agg(['first', 'last']) take the firs non-na values.

    I interpreted this as, it must then be necessary to run this column by column. Further, forcing index level=1 to align may not even make sense.

    Let's include another test

    df = pd.DataFrame(np.arange(20).reshape(10, -1),
                      [list('aaaabbbccd'),
                       list('abcdefghij')],
                      list('XY'))
    
    df.loc[tuple('aa'), 'X'] = np.nan
    

    def first_last(df):
        return df.ix[[0, -1]]
    
    df.groupby(level=0, group_keys=False).apply(first_last)
    

    df.reset_index(1).groupby(level=0).agg(['first', 'last']).stack() \
        .set_index('level_1', append=True).reset_index(1, drop=True) \
        .rename_axis([None, None])
    

    Sure enough! This second solution is taking the first valid value in column X. It is now nonsensical to have forced that value to align with the index a.
